Playing Dead by Allison Brennan


 This was a really great book. Moved very fast. Very hard to put down. 

Claire O'Brien is a private investigator and is working on a arson case for the company she works for. When she was fourteen her mother and the guy she was sleeping with were shot in her bed. Her father, Tom was the one they were looking at. He went to trial and was sentenced to death. Claire always believed he did it. Then, one day a young guy came knocking on her door to tell her that he may not be guilty. 

Mitch Bianchi is a FBI Agent and has been seeing Claire for awhile. He's been wondering if she's heard from her father. Partly because he escaped from prison. It's good if she was to talk to him about anything and right now she's not speaking to much. 

Mitch knows that he's got feelings for her and has been trying to keep from making love to her. It's very hard on him.

There is an assassin that had killed her mom and the guy she was with. He also wants Claire very badly. But, for him he needs to control himself. He don't want to hurt her, so he goes after other girls and ladies. Its the only way he can be around her for now. 

Claire ends up seeing her father and he tells her he's not guilty. At first she fights him. He explains that there was a young guy looking into it. He then, ended up disappearing. Claire decides to look into it for herself. She's good at what she does. She's not going to be making to many friends and there are many people that will find out what she's doing. 

A judge, a congressman and a very rich guy. All have something to lose. They will do everything to keep what they have done from coming out. 

Mitch and his partner find that young guy in the river not far from a small town. What they aren't sure of is why he's there in the first place.

The school of good and evil by Soman Chainani


 This is the first book in a middle grade series. I enjoyed the fast pacing of this book. Quite gripping and pulls you in. Very easy to read. 

Sophie and Agatha are friends. Sophie would go visit Agatha at her house which was on a hill behind a graveyard. People in town would call Agatha a witch. Sophie, has high hopes of going to the school of good and evil to win herself a prince. She wanted so much to be a princess. 

When they both one night disappear and end up at the school. They both end up with a huge shock. Sophie ends up in the house of evil and Agatha ends up in the house of good. Which they both believe they are in the wrong schools. Agathia just wants to go home and take Sophie with her. But, it doesn't happen. 

Then, Sophie sees Tedros from across the room and chooses him as her prince. But, because he's not in her school he can't be. Her roommates tell her that evil girls can't have princes. It never works out. Sophie don't care. She's going to do everything she can to make sure it happens. He does see how pretty she is and notices that he's looking at her. 

Agatha, really knows that she doesn't belong. Some of the girls call her a witch. In some ways she believes she might be. She also knows that if she can go see the head master who's in a tower away from everyone else. That maybe he can help both her and Sophie get back home. 

Strange things happen between them and they don't stay friends. Sophie end up becoming evil and starts to gain witchy powers. Agatha tries to do what she can to save Sophie and all the others in the school.
